Goalie Jonathan Bernier practiced with the Kings for the first time Tuesday. He and defenseman Thomas Hickey played for Canada in the Canada-Russia Super Series over the past two weeks. They played a game in Vancouver on Sunday, woke up at 4 a.m. Monday, boarded a plane to Los Angeles and arrived in time to take physicals.

Bernier, who allowed one goal in two starts for Canada, said he felt like he was already in peak form entering training camp, and it showed with him getting glowing reviews from coach Marc Crawford for his first day.

``I know I didn't play many games but I had a lot of practice over there,'' Bernier said. ``We had a week in Moscow where we practiced two times a day. So I guess I'm in pretty good form right now. For sure I would have liked to participate in the prospect camp but I got some great experience.''
